Transaction e8914e04b8330940e61c013be8b7e08f9272c222eaa52f61c54cb0c81d2fc17b
1 Input
1 Output
-
e8914e04b8330940e61c013be8b7e08f9272c222eaa52f61c54cb0c81d2fc17b:0
- value
- 427606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89c3ca886c18d7916bce914f5b265f5dc3ef2296 OP_EQUAL
- address
- 3EFT3dbKEX986KUzpzUB5d2FFj8wMxBo8t